Because someone doesn't speak English well or whatsoever doesn't mean they shouldn't obtain high quality drug abuse rehabilitation inside an an effective alcohol and drug treatment center. Clients that don't speak English should acquire rehab services which are just as effective as they are for English speaking clients, and that's why there are alcohol and drug rehabilitation centers available to cater to clientele who speak other languages. Rehabilitation details are supplied in drug and alcohol treatment programs across the nation in a number of languages. So even if the alcohol and drug rehabilitation facility of choice isn't exclusively available in a particular language, there are lots of facilities offering English services but in addition have rehabilitation professionals on staff that use other languages. Folks who speak other languages can take part in some of the most effective programs around, for example inpatient and residential alcohol and drug treatment centers which provide rehabilitation using their language. The centers who do offer treatment in other languages may also be often sensitive to the cultural needs of the clients, and supply amenities and an environment to help meet these needs when possible. All those who are struggling with drug abuse should and will have another opportunity at life at any of the numerous drug rehab facilities that service clients in other languages.
